Dear SEC,

As a private investor with 20+ years of experience investing, access to leveraged funds are critical to my portfolio and my investment/trading style. Investors are completely capable of understanding leveraged and inverse funds and their performance characteristics, and I don't want a third party evaluating my capability to do so and potentially preventing me from buying them.

Access to these funds is one way a private investor can be put on the same playing field as hedge funds who have all sorts of privileged access to investment opportunities.

I want to preserve the long-standing free public markets where investors have to freedom to buy public securities without additional government-imposed limitations.
